Wisconsin cities show diverse home values with some experiencing up to 10.9% one-year price rises amid rising mortgage rates of 6.22%, data from Zillow shows.
- Using February 2026 Zillow data, Stacker compiled a list ranking Wisconsin cities by home prices based on the Zillow Home Values Index.
- Nationally, the typical home value in the United States was $361,371 in February, 0.4% higher year-over-year, with location, size, age and condition driving local price differences.
- Notably, Oconomowoc Lake has a typical home value of 2m, while Maple Bluff is at 970,596 and Manitowish Waters at 645,220, illustrating high prices in small places.
- As mortgage rates rose, the 30‑year fixed mortgage rate reached 6.22% on March 19, making monthly mortgage payments more expensive and reducing affordability.
